Many people select their beach wedding packages Hawaii based on where they’re staying on the island. That’s fine, but keep in mind that there are fewer choices for acceptable wedding beaches on the West Side of Maui. Because of that reason, if you select a West Side Maui wedding beach, expect there to be more visitors enjoying their beach time on the same beach as your wedding. Many couples are surprised when they show up for their wedding and find that they’ve selected a very popular time or place for beach goers. Having a Maui wedding on Ka’anapali Beach is no longer an option since the State of Hawaii has banned commercial activity on the beach; however there are beautiful alternatives. If you feel like taking a small hike, check out Ironwood Beach – recommended for early morning weddings. We offer beach wedding packages Hawaii here.

One of the most popular wedding beaches on the West Side is Kapalua Bay. Being popular does not mean it is the most ideal Maui wedding beach. Being popular just means that many people select it for their wedding or honeymoon pictures location. Read into this “popular=often times busy”.

Many brides and grooms are drawn to the magical legends surrounding the beach known as Makena Cove. The pictures are spectacular online. What you should know about Makena Cove…… those pictures were captured by professional photographers that know how to take pictures without the onlookers showing in the background. It is a rare and special occasion to have Makena Cove (aka Secret Cove) all to ourselves. We do watch the trends to give our clients the best possible opportunity for privacy on this beach; however, as brides and grooms you should know that at times there can be up to 6 weddings on this small patch of sand. You need to be prepared that this can happen, and does frequently.

One of my favorite wedding beaches is White Rock Beach. Some might not think of it as a favorite wedding beach, but here’s 5 reasons why I do…

1. There’s plenty of space so if there are beach goers on the beach, we can get away from them.

2. There’s beautiful background scenery – lava rocks, tropical trees… Your photographer is in heaven working with you here

3. It’s often not the first idea for wedding planners which is great for those that do use it.

4. Parking is easy

5. A restroom option was added this past year.
